Die Quellen des Bösen - Season 1
Season 1
Episodes
Das Mädchen
The body of a girl is found in the jackdaw forest. What do the mysterious symbols etched into her skin mean? While Koray Larssen suspects a serial killer, Ulrike Bandow follows clues that lead to the local neo-Nazi scene. She meets her former best friend Christa, whose husband Frank seems to have connections to the victim. Ulrike soon suspects that this case leads into her own past and hides important details from her new colleague Larssen that could lead to the perpetrator.
Die Runen
Ulrike and Larssen don't have much time: a second girl is missing. You must find the kidnapped child before he falls victim to the Rune Murderer. Ulrike has no idea that her brother Marc is becoming increasingly involved in the case and the strange girl Ingrid also seems to know more than she dares to say. Larssen, on the other hand, pursues his own goals. Can Ulrike really count on him?
Der Wolf
After Danjana's thwarted kidnapping, Ulrike remembers having also encountered the monstrous wolf in her childhood. Christa should know more, but she remains silent. Hoping to find out more about the past, Ulrike goes to visit her mother in Hamburg. Nothing is holding Larssen back in Wussitz now, because he has finally found what he was looking for all along. Is he really ready to leave Ulrike behind with the case?
Das Grab
Ulrike and Larssen realize that unknown forces are complicating their investigation. While they find out more and more about the identity of the rune murderer, Ingrid goes alone in the forest to search for the perpetrator and puts herself in great danger. Larssen suffers a painful loss and Ulrike is his support at this moment. Together they take an important step into the dark depths of the case.
Der Vater
An old file brings new insights that confront Ulrike with her own guilt. Larssen's personal secret becomes his undoing and he is faced with a decision that would upset the investigation. Meanwhile, the Rune Killer circles around his next victim, just waiting for the right moment to finally strike. But Ulrike and Larssen are still missing the crucial piece of the puzzle to prevent another murder.
Das Böse
The case turns out to be a complex network and the unpredictable perpetrator is once again one step ahead of the investigators. Larssen has abused Ulrike's trust and they part ways. While the rune murderer's victim fears for his life, Ulrike's only option is to go it alone. She knows the serial killer is obsessed with his merciless plan and is willing to risk her own life to save two others.
